The Benefits and Features of Aluminium Front Doors

Aluminium front doors are gaining immense popularity among house owners aiming to boost their residential or commercial property's curb appeal while making sure resilience and security. This comprehensive guide checks out the benefits, functions, and considerations of aluminium front doors, in addition to insights into upkeep and installation.

What Are Aluminium Front Doors?

Aluminium front doors are outside entryways made mainly from aluminium, a light-weight yet robust metal. Understood for their sleek design and minimalistic looks, these doors provide a modern-day appearance suitable for different architectural designs. They can be ended up in numerous colours or textures, allowing property owners to customize their entrance.

Advantages of Aluminium Front Doors

  1. Sturdiness: Aluminium is resistant to rust, corrosion, and warping. Unlike wooden doors, aluminium does not swell or diminish due to moisture modifications.
  2. Security: These doors are typically geared up with multi-point locking systems, making them more protected than standard wooden or PVC doors.
  3. Energy Efficiency: Modern aluminium doors are developed with thermal breaks to enhance insulation, assisting to reduce energy costs.
  4. Low Maintenance: Unlike wooden doors that may need regular staining or painting, aluminium doors need only occasional cleaning to keep their appearance.
  5. Aesthetic Versatility: Available in numerous designs, surfaces, and colours, aluminium doors can fit any home style, from modern to standard.
  6. Environmental Impact: Aluminium is recyclable, and lots of producers produce doors utilizing recycled materials, making them an eco-friendly option.

Functions of Aluminium Front Doors

When considering aluminium front doors, a number of key functions deserve exploring:

FeatureDescription
Thermal BreakA separation in the door frame that minimizes heat transfer, boosting insulation and energy efficiency.
Multi-Point Locking SystemA locking system that secures the door at multiple points, offering improved security.
Customisation OptionsOptions in colour, surface (anodized, powder-coated), and glass inserts (frosted, clear, or patterned).
Weather condition ResistanceDesigned to withstand extreme weather condition conditions, preventing leakages and drafts.
Minimalist DesignFeatures tidy lines and a classy appearance that complements contemporary architectural designs.
Top quality GlazingChoices for double or triple glazing to improve insulation and lower sound pollution.

Considerations Before Installation

Before choosing aluminium front doors, property owners should consider the list below aspects:

  • Budget: Aluminium doors can be more costly upfront than conventional wooden doors, but they might provide long-lasting savings due to their resilience and energy efficiency.
  • Setup Complexity: Professional installation is typically advised for aluminium doors, as inappropriate setup can negate their benefits.
  • Regional Climate: While aluminium is weather-resistant, specific finishes might perform much better in extreme climates.
  • Regulative Compliance: Ensure the chosen door meets local building codes and policies, specifically concerning security and energy effectiveness.

Maintenance of Aluminium Front Doors

While aluminium doors are reasonably low upkeep, they do require some care to ensure longevity: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use mild soap and water to clean up the surface periodically. Avoid abrasive cleaners that could scratch the surface.
  • Inspect Seals: Check weather condition stripping and seals routinely for wear and tear, replacing them as necessary to keep energy efficiency.
  • Oil Locks and Hinges: A touch of silicone lube on locks and hinges can prevent rust and ensure smooth operation.
